Perryman Construction Services

Site and Utility Construction Foreman

Lewiston, Maine

We are looking for an experienced site/utility Foreman to lead daily operations on our construction projects. In this role you will supervise crews, ensure safety compliance, interpret plans, coordinate materials, and work with your PM to keep projects on schedule and within budget. You’ll serve as the key liaison between the crew, project managers, and owner representatives.

If you’re a strong leader with solid construction experience, we want to hear from you!

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ead, train, and mentor crew members and subcontractors to maintain productivity and morale
  • Plan and coordinate daily tasks schedules, and workflows
  • Enforce all OSHA safety regulations, conduct toolbox talks, and ensure proper use of PPE
  • Inspect work to ensure it meets plans, specifications, and building codes.
  • Work with project manager (PM) on ordering materials, managing tools, and equipment maintenance.
  • Provide clear daily progress reports to PM and owner representatives
  • Read and interpret project plan sets and specifications to layout work for the crew

Required Skills and Qualifications

  • 5+ years of experience as a foreman in site/utility construction
  • Strong knowledge of construction procedures, equipment operation, and safety standards
  • Ability to read plan sets and operate key pieces of heavy equipment
  • Leadership skills - able to manage teams, resolve conflicts, and make decisions under pressure
  • Physical ability to work outdoors in varying weather conditions and lift 50+ lbs
  • OSHA 10 certification (or willingness to obtain)
  • High school diploma or equivalent; construction management education is a plus
  • Valid driver's license
